If they sprout then they are raw. Even if someone says yes, that doesn't mean the ones you are looking at haven't been pasteurized or something. Purchase a small quantity and try sprouting them.
I have heard that they are not raw,. a lot of grain products are irradiated first. i don't think that an oat groat that has been chopped up can sprout anymore (I have tried it) , but I eat them anyway by soaking them, for breakfast, and they are delicious, because I am not 100% strict about raw. If you prefer raw only, try buckwheat groats (untoasted) they sprout. :-)
